#d1389b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1389b is composed of 82% red, 22%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 25.8%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 321.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 52%. #d1389b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#a30037.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#d1389b color description : Moderate pink.
#d1389b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1389b has RGB values of R:209, G:56,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.26,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13711515.

Shades and Tints of #d1389b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080206 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1389b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868385 is the less saturated color, while #f712a6 is the most saturated one.
